St. Erasmus Hospital in Ohrid received a neurosurgical microscope for the first time, patients will not have to travel to Skopje

The special hospital "St. Erasmus" in Ohrid for the first time received a neurosurgical microscope with which a brain tumor operation was performed, informed on his Facebook profile the former Minister of Health Venko Filipce.
Today, with my colleagues Dr. Milosevski and Dr. Micunovic, we performed surgery on a brain tumor with a surgical microscope. This sophisticated microscope provides an accurate and detailed image of the operating field. Now in the hospital "St. "Erasmus" with the help of this modern method and the expertise of doctors will be able to perform difficult operations in the field of neurosurgery, and patients will not have to travel to Skopje for surgery, he wrote.

He wished his colleagues success in their further work, and the patient who underwent surgery today to recover as soon as possible.
